# Node.js Core Benchmarks

This folder contains code and data used to measure performance
of different Node.js implementations and different ways of
writing JavaScript run by the built-in JavaScript engine.

### Other Top-level files

The top-level files include common dependencies of the benchmarks
and the tools for launching benchmarks and visualizing their output.
The actual benchmark scripts should be placed in their corresponding
directories.

* `_benchmark_progress.js`: implements the progress bar displayed
  when running `compare.js`
* `_cli.js`: parses the command line arguments passed to `compare.js`,
  `run.js` and `scatter.js`
* `_cli.R`: parses the command line arguments passed to `compare.R`
* `_http-benchmarkers.js`: selects and runs external tools for benchmarking
  the `http` subsystem.
* `common.js`: see [Common API](#common-api).
* `compare.js`: command line tool for comparing performance between different
  Node.js binaries.
* `compare.R`: R script for statistically analyzing the output of
  `compare.js`
* `run.js`: command line tool for running individual benchmark suite(s).
* `scatter.js`: command line tool for comparing the performance
  between different parameters in benchmark configurations,
  for example to analyze the time complexity.
* `scatter.R`: R script for visualizing the output of `scatter.js` with
  scatter plots.

## Common API

The common.js module is used by benchmarks for consistency across repeated
tasks. It has a number of helpful functions and properties to help with
writing benchmarks.

### sendResult(data)

Used in special benchmarks that can't use `createBenchmark` and the object
it returns to accomplish what they need. This function reports timing
data to the parent process (usually created by running `compare.js`, `run.js` or
`scatter.js`).
